If you can summarize what you’re trying to do with a bike, it’d be a lot easier to recommend the right tool for the job. For most people, a front suspension mountain bike (hard tail) with 100-120mm of travel would do most things they want to do well. I highly suggest looking at the secondary market like pink bike, Facebook marketplace, and Craigslist.
